Dynafiber
| Item | Fiber Optical Transceivers |
| Compatible With | Cisco/Huawei/Hpe |
| Part Status | Active |
| Form Factor | 1x9 |
| Max Data Rate | 1.25G |
| Max Cable Distance | 20km/40km/80km/120km |
| Wavelength | 1310nm/1550nm |
| Connector | SC FC |
| Power Consumption | <1W |
| DDM/DOM | DDM Supported |
| Commercial Temperature Range | 0 to 70°C (32 to 158°F) |
| EMC | Supported |
| Warranty | 5 Years |
| Sample | Available |
